WebJun 26, 2024 · There are generally two sets of penalties if you are caught selling alcohol to a minor. One is issued in relation to your clerk (who actually made the sale), and another to you, the license holder or licensee (the under age minor can also be charged, of course). The punishment for making alcoholic beverages available to a minor … WebThe penalty for selling alcohol to a minor in Texas is a Class A Misdemeanor, meaning that you face up to a year in jail and up to a $4,000 fine if convicted for the offense. You also face the automatic suspension of your driver’s license for 180 days upon conviction of selling alcohol to a minor in Texas. Back to Top how to run telnet command in windows 10
